Ken Mogi’s experiment was to improvise a talk in which he says nightmares are the mothers of dreams. Things like fear, anxiety and problems, appearing at first glance to be bad, are actually worth accepting into your life.

Ken Mogi / Brain scientist
While researching the enigmas of the mind and brain, Dr. Mogi is a critic of literature and the fine arts. Besides actively holding lectures, making television appearances and writing, he engages with his over 900k Twitter followers. Many of those showing great interest in his work are students at the University of Tokyo."
